Which Of The Following Services Use Tcp?
Explain the TCP Services in the Computer Network.
Post-obit are some of the services offered past the Transmission Control Protocol (TCP) to the processes at the awarding layer:
- Stream Delivery Service.
- Sending and Receiving Buffers.
- Bytes and Segments.
- Total Duplex Service
- Connection Oriented Service.
- Reliable Service.
All the higher up mentioned TCP services are explained below in detail.
Stream Delivery Service
TCP is a stream-oriented protocol. It enables the sending procedure to evangelize data as a stream of bytes and the receiving process to acquire data as a stream of bytes.
TCP creates a working surroundings so that the sending and receiving procedures are connected by an imaginary "tube", as shown in the figure below:
Sending and Receiving Buffers
The sending and receiving processes cannot produce and receive data at the same speed. Hence, TCP needs a buffer for storage.
There are ii methods of buffers used in each dissection, which are as follows:
- Sending Buffer
- Receiving Buffer
A buffer tin can be implemented by using a circular array of 1-byte location, as shown in the figure beneath. The figure shows the movement of data in ane direction on the sending side.
The buffer has three types of locations, which are as follows:
- Empty Locations.
- Locations that contain the bytes which have been sent, but not best-selling. These bytes are kept in the buffer till an acquittance is received.
- The location that contains the bytes which are to be sent by the sending TCP
In practice, the TCP may send only a port of data due to the slowness of the receiving process or congestion in the network.
The buffer at the receiver is divided into two parts as mentioned below:
- The office was containing empty locations.
- The part was containing the received bytes, which the sending process tin consume.
Bytes and Segments
Buffering is used to handle the difference between the speed of data transmission and information consumption. Merely only buffering is not enough.
Nosotros demand 1 more step before sending the data on the Internet Protocol (IP) layer as a TCP service provider. It needs to send data in the form of packets and not as a stream of bytes.
At the transport layer, TCP groups several bytes into a packet and this is called a segment. A header is added to each segment to exercise control.
The segment is encapsulated in an IP diagram and so transmitted. The entire operation is transparent to the receiving process. The segment may exist deceived out of club, lost or corrupted when it receives the receiving end.
The figure given below shows how the segments are created from the bytes in the buffers:
The segments are not of the aforementioned size. Each segment tin can carry hundreds of bytes.
Full-Duplex Service
TCP offers a total-duplex service where the data can flow in both directions simultaneously. Each TCP will then have a sending buffer and receiving buffer. The TCP segments are sent in both directions.
Connection-Oriented Service
We are already aware that the TCP is a connection-oriented protocol. When a process wants to communicate (send and receive) with another process (procedure -two), the sequence of operations is as follows:
- TCP of process-ane informs TCP of process-2 and gets its approval.
- TCP of process-1 tells TCP of process-2 exchange information in both directions.
- Later completing the data commutation, when buffers on both sides are empty, the two TCPs destroy their buffers
The type of connexion in TCP is not physical, but information technology is virtual. The TCP segment encapsulated in an IP datagram can be sent out of society. These segments can get lost or corrupted and may have to be resend. Each segment may take a different path to accomplish the destination.
Reliable Service
TCP is a reliable transport protocol. Information technology uses an acknowledgment mechanism for checking the safe and sound arrival of data.
Published on 04-May-2021 08:53:38
- Related Questions & Answers
- Explicate the TCP Service Model in Reckoner Network
- Explicate the services provided past Network Layer in Computer Network.
- What is the TCP Protocol in Computer Network?
- What are the services of Network Security in Computer Network?
- Explain the ATM Jail cell Structure in Computer Network
- Explain the Due east-Postal service Format in Estimator Network.
- Explain the functions of WAN in Computer Network
- Explain the Token Ring Network (IEEE Standard 802.5) in Estimator Network.
- What is Transmission Control Protocol (TCP) in Reckoner Network?
- Explicate the Orthogonal Frequency Division Multiplexing in Calculator Network.
- Explicate various Computer Network Models
- Explain the TCP Connectedness Direction
- The Reckoner Network Layer
- Explain the services of the physical layer
- The Host-to-Network Layer in TCP/IP Model
Which Of The Following Services Use Tcp?,
Source: https://www.tutorialspoint.com/explain-the-tcp-services-in-the-computer-network
Posted by: powellreadeary.blogspot.com
0 Response to "Which Of The Following Services Use Tcp?"
Post a Comment